    Abstract: A trashcan assembly can include a body portion, a lid portion pivotably coupled with the body portion, and a sensor assembly configured to generate a signal when an object is detected within a sensing region. The sensor assembly can include a plurality of transmitters having a first subset of transmitters and a second subset of transmitters. A transmission axis of at least one transmitter in the first subset of transmitters can be different from a transmission axis of at least one of the transmitters in the second subset of transmitters. An electronic processor can generate an electronic signal to a power-operated drive mechanism for moving the lid portion from a closed position to an open position, such as in response to the sensor assembly detecting the object.

    Abstract: A soap dispenser can be configured to dispense an amount of liquid soap, for example, upon detecting the presence of an object. Certain embodiments of the dispenser include a housing, reservoir, pump, motor, sensor, electronic processor, and nozzle. In certain embodiments, the sensor can be configured to generate a signal based on a distance between an object and the sensor. In certain embodiments, the electronic processor can be configured to receive the signal from the sensor and to determine a dispensation volume of the liquid. The dispensation volume can vary as a function of the distance between the object and the sensor. The processor can be configured to control the motor to dispense approximately the dispensation volume of the liquid.

    Abstract: A mirror system can include a mirror assembly and a protective portion, such as a holder or cover. A mirror assembly can include a housing portion, a mirror, a light source, a light conveying channel, and an orienting structure. In some embodiments, the mirror assembly includes a component interaction actuator, such as a switch, configured to automatically activate or deactivate when two components in the mirror system interact or cease interacting. In some embodiments, the mirror assembly is configured to turn on upon removal of at least a portion of the mirror assembly from at least a portion of the protective portion and to turn off upon at least a portion of the mirror assembly being received by at least a portion of the protective portion. In some embodiments, a user can hold the mirror assembly and use the orienting structure as a finger-retaining portion. In some embodiments, the user can use the orienting structure as a stand for the mirror assembly. In some embodiments, the user can use the protective portion as a stand for the mirror assembly.
